Output d8affe7addc8fa83ffb40c82faa76ed847ca36f1595a35deec19d02ce61770f2:11

value
65412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8a5cdbb8ae99ebb547bf4cd921d2fb0c755dd7 OP_EQUAL
address
3DE6pKpNfVivabuwvAYBm6S2uHmsxVyK7x
transaction
d8affe7addc8fa83ffb40c82faa76ed847ca36f1595a35deec19d02ce61770f2
confirmations
120781
spent
true